Output c2517ff034486aeab05bf3ccb2a42ad1d7bba6d71faedb567c1d1b86c2742152:1

value
2104482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5eaf2f8faa6609f4a278365ce478212c9a9bd33 OP_EQUAL
address
3MC7JxHqTGxCmLoUF2GYt58cbiVhnVRtk7
transaction
c2517ff034486aeab05bf3ccb2a42ad1d7bba6d71faedb567c1d1b86c2742152
spent
true